Day 1: Delhi Sightseeing + Drive to Agra
✅ Morning – Arrival and Old/New Delhi Tour
You’ll be picked up from your hotel or the airport in Delhi. Begin your journey by exploring:
-
Jama Masjid – One of the largest mosques in India
-
Rickshaw ride in Chandni Chowk – A bustling bazaar of colors and chaos
-
Raj Ghat – Memorial of Mahatma Gandhi
-
India Gate, President’s House, and Parliament Building (Drive-by)
-
Qutub Minar – UNESCO World Heritage Site
-
Humayun’s Tomb – The Mughal marvel that inspired the Taj Mahal
???? Evening – Drive to Agra (Approx. 3-4 hours)
Arrive in Agra by evening. Check-in to your hotel and relax.
Overnight Stay: Agra
Day 2: Taj Mahal Sunrise Tour + Drive to Jaipur
???? Early Morning – Taj Mahal at Sunrise
Visit the Taj Mahal in the early morning light – when the white marble monument glows in soft hues. Your guide will explain the heartbreaking love story behind its creation.
???? Later Morning – Agra Fort
Explore the Agra Fort, a massive Mughal fortress with royal palaces and beautiful views of the Taj from a distance.
???? Optional: Visit Mehtab Bagh or Itimad-ud-Daulah (Baby Taj)
???? Afternoon – Drive to Jaipur (Approx. 4-5 hours)
En route, stop at Fatehpur Sikri, the ghost city built by Emperor Akbar. It's filled with beautiful red sandstone palaces and mosques.
Arrive in Jaipur by evening and check into your hotel.
Overnight Stay: Jaipur
Day 3: Jaipur Sightseeing + Return to Delhi
???? Morning – Explore the Pink City
Visit Jaipur’s top attractions with your local guide:
-
Amber Fort – Ride an elephant or jeep to the top of this stunning hilltop fortress
-
City Palace – A blend of Mughal and Rajasthani architecture
-
Jantar Mantar – An ancient astronomical observatory
-
Hawa Mahal (Palace of Winds) – Iconic honeycomb façade perfect for photos
-
Jal Mahal (Water Palace) – A serene stop for photos by the lake
???? Evening – Drive back to Delhi (Approx. 5 hours)
Return to Delhi by late evening. You’ll be dropped off at your hotel or the airport for your onward journey.

Best Time to Do the Golden Triangle Tour
The most pleasant time to visit is October to March, when the weather is ideal for sightseeing. Summer months (April-June) can be very hot, while July-September may bring monsoon rains.
